Review On Jurassic 5, DJ Nu Mark and Roots Manuva  

After cunningly moshing during Hundred Reasons I was able to be 1 person away from the front for the next act to follow on the main stage, which was Jurassic 5.     

They started off by coming out 1 by 1 and playing I Am Somebody, working the crowd a treat. A few idiots threw bottles but J5 look past it and went on to play one of the best sets at the festival. All the crowd respected one of the best hip hop groups that there has been.     

After watching J5 I went to the dance tent where i stayed for the remainder of the night. Before Nu-Mark came on Shystie played, a garage MC who was very good but after that a band called LCD came on and they weren't much to shout about. After they had finished and the next group came on called "!!!" Nu-Mark started setting up. I was right by the front by a poll so I would be able to watch without getting squashed and still have a great view, this turned out to be a major plus. When "!!!" came on it was some lunatic who i didn't pay much attention to, he showed no respect to Nu-Mark by jumping on the table where he was setting up his equipment, i was thinking '...doesn't this wanker have any clue of whose equipment he is nearly fucking up..." then he started doing some homosexual dance right in front of me on the poll. I was glad when they had finished. Time for Nu-Mark.....     His set begins 20 minutes behind schedule as something had happened previously during the day, not that i cared about that as I was front row and was watching him work his magic. 10 minutes of his set has gone to quick when he comes and sits directly in front of me...... Akil from Jurassic 5, I was thinking this is to good to be true, and shake his hand, moments later Tuna casually sits down on the speakers. Then the rest were casually watching Nu-Mark to my right. At that moment in time I was probably the only person that had realised all of this. Nu-Marks set was mainly tracks from his new album which is a must to get. He played an unbelievable set, which paved the way nicely for Roots Manuva.....     

To my surprise J5 stayed as Roots Manuva started his performance, the whole affair was very casual with the band members sat atop speaker stacks and laughing and joking with the crowd. And getting down to the music along with few thousand people packed into the dance tent. I was enjoying the whole thing SO much and believed it wouldn't get any better, until Roots Manuva asked the crowd if they knew his homeboy from LA. He kept on asking, and I knew it was going to be one of J5. Then Tuna jumped down off of the speaker and Roots Manuva announced that Tuna was about to join the stage to do a duet of 'join the dots'. The crowd went wild and the whole dance tent was rocking. Tuna then came down to crowd level and started shaking the crowds hand and 1 of them jus happened to be. The set finished with Witness the Fitness which was electric.    

I ended up going back to my tent smiling and don't think it has rubbed off yet. All 3 sets were amazing and they were the highlight of my weekend. (Excluding Dizzee Rascal)
